When checking fund prices, I get a "Could not create internet output file. Please verify, etc." Also, when attempting a backup or exiting, I get an "Access Denied" and "Portfolio Autosave Failed." This is a Vista sytem using FM v 9.6. From my research here in the forum, it appears that this is a Vista-related problem or permissions-related problem. My FM file location is C:\Users\Jim\Documents\FundManager\My_Data. I'm stumped at the moment...

Did this problem just start, or have you recently upgraded to Vista?

I would suggest going to the location of the internet output log file, and checking both the read-only attribute, and the security permission levels to make sure your user has permission to write to this file. Check all the files in this folder:

C:\Users\<yourusername>\AppData\Roaming\Fund Manager

Please note, AppData is a hidden folder.

If your portfolio autosave is failing with a permission denied error, check these same properties for your portfolio file (*.mm4).
